House Bill 560 - Public Safety Reform Summary
-
Transfers probation officer oversight from the Secretary of Public Safety to the Department of Adult Correction, effective January 1, 2023.
-
Increases maximum daily pay for inmates with special skills from $3.00 to $5.00 per day, effective January 1, 2023.
-
Raises crime victim compensation limits from $30,000 to $45,000 aggregate and increases funeral/burial expense coverage from $5,000 to $10,000, effective August 1, 2022.
-
Authorizes the Post-Release Supervision and Parole Commission to issue temporary or conditional revocation orders and enter them into the Criminal Justice Law Enforcement Automated Data System (CJLEADS).
-
Establishes a Continuously Operating Reference Station (CORS) Fund for the North Carolina Geodetic Survey's Real Time Network operations and allows the Department of Public Safety to use up to $500,000 for an online crime victim compensation application process.
